Quick Context: What You Are Shopping For
When a buyer asks an AI engine to recommend an option in your category, your brand is in the answer or it is not. AEO - Answer Engine Optimization - is the practice of getting you cited and described well.
Every tool below tracks this. The differences are how many engines they cover, how much they help you act, and what you pay to get there.

2. Peec AI: Best for pure analytics
Peec AI is a polished analytics platform tracking five engines on standard plans, with strong sentiment and geographic segmentation. Clean data layer, but no content engine or marketplace, and no public pricing.
3. Profound: Best for large enterprises
Profound is a deep, enterprise-grade platform analyzing prompt volumes and how models represent your brand, now adding content agents. Sales-led, no public pricing, no marketplace. Built for Fortune 500 teams.
4. Otterly: Best for a cheap starting point
Otterly is a lightweight tracker from $29 a month for 15 prompts and four core engines. A low-risk entry point, but monitoring only.
5. Scrunch: Best for technical teams
Scrunch adds AI bot crawl monitoring and an Agent Experience Platform serving machine-readable pages to AI agents, across six engines, from around $250 a month annually. Strong with engineers behind it.
6. Goodie AI: Best for commerce and content
Goodie AI is an enterprise AEO platform with prompt research, an AEO Writer for content, and an agentic commerce suite for product visibility in AI shopping. Demo-only pricing, no publisher marketplace.
7. Brandlight: Best for global enterprise brands
Brandlight is a top-end enterprise AEO platform used by names like Volkswagen Group and Publicis, with content optimization and publisher partnership intelligence. No public pricing, aimed at the largest brands.
8. Rankscale: Best for broad engine coverage
Rankscale tracks 17+ AI engines with an AI rank tracker, page audits on 200+ factors, and prompt research. Strong on breadth and diagnostics, no content generation or marketplace.
9. HubSpot AEO Grader: Best free check
HubSpot's free AEO Grader scores how ChatGPT, Perplexity, and Gemini describe your brand across five dimensions. A quick one-off snapshot, not a platform.
